In its most recent EPIC decision [PDF], the CPUC directed that program-wide goals are needed to evaluate the progress of innovation investments and the extent to which investment plan portfolios maximize ratepayer benefits and impacts in achieving California's clean energy and climate goals.

The CPUC is launching a new EPIC Strategic Goals Workshop process to inform how Strategic Goals should be articulated and established by the Commission in its next guidance Decision for the EPIC 5 funding cycle (2026-2030).

Purpose

The Strategic Goals Workshop Process will focus on identifying four core elements:

  • Pathways: Set of critical actions necessary to support meeting the State's 2045 zero carbon goals via the most effective strategies and technology innovation.
  • Gaps: Key challenges for achieving zero carbon goals and how RD&D should be prioritized to address opportunities and barriers more quickly along critical pathways.
  • Roles: The best-positioned stakeholders (ratepayers, state, federal, private sector) to lead innovation investment addressing identified gaps, including through coordination and collaboration.
  • Outcomes: Clear, measurable, and reasonable targets to be used by administrators in developing EPIC portfolios and used in program evaluations to measure impacts of EPIC in supporting achievement of California's 2045 zero carbon goals.
